KudanAR - iOS  1.6.0
OgreMathLib::Quaternion Member List

This is the complete list of members for OgreMathLib::Quaternion, including all inherited members.

Dot(const Quaternion &rkQ) const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
equals(const Quaternion &rhs, const Radian &tolerance) constOgreMathLib::Quaternion
Exp() const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
FromAngleAxis(const Radian &rfAngle, const Vector3 &rkAxis) (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
FromAxes(const Vector3 *akAxis) (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
FromAxes(const Vector3 &xAxis, const Vector3 &yAxis, const Vector3 &zAxis) (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
FromRotationMatrix(const Matrix3 &kRot) (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
getPitch(bool reprojectAxis=true) constOgreMathLib::Quaternion
getRoll(bool reprojectAxis=true) constOgreMathLib::Quaternion
getYaw(bool reprojectAxis=true) constOgreMathLib::Quaternion
IDENTITY (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ternionstatic
Intermediate(const Quaternion &rkQ0, const Quaternion &rkQ1, const Quaternion &rkQ2, Quaternion &rka, Quaternion &rkB) (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ternionstatic
Inverse() const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
isNaN() constOgreMathLib::Quaternioninline
Log() const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
ms_fEpsilon (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ternionstatic
nlerp(Real fT, const Quaternion &rkP, const Quaternion &rkQ, bool shortestPath=false) (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ternionstatic
Norm() const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
normalise(void)OgreMathLib::Quaternion
operator!=(const Quaternion &rhs) const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ternioninline
operator*(const Quaternion &rkQ) const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
operator*(Real fScalar) const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
operator* (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ternionfriend
operator*(const Vector3 &rkVector) const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
operator+(const Quaternion &rkQ) const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
operator-(const Quaternion &rkQ) const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
operator-() const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
operator<<(std::ostream &o, const Quaternion &q)OgreMathLib::Quaternionfriend
operator=(const Quaternion &rkQ) (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ternioninline
operator==(const Quaternion &rhs) const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ternioninline
operator[](const size_t i) constOgreMathLib::Quaternioninline
operator[](const size_t i)OgreMathLib::Quaternioninline
ptr()OgreMathLib::Quaternioninline
ptr() constOgreMathLib::Quaternioninline
Quaternion()OgreMathLib::Quaternioninline
Quaternion(Real fW, Real fX, Real fY, Real fZ)OgreMathLib::Quaternioninline
Quaternion(const Matrix3 &rot)OgreMathLib::Quaternioninline
Quaternion(const Radian &rfAngle, const Vector3 &rkAxis)OgreMathLib::Quaternioninline
Quaternion(const Vector3 &xaxis, const Vector3 &yaxis, const Vector3 &zaxis)OgreMathLib::Quaternioninline
Quaternion(const Vector3 *akAxis)OgreMathLib::Quaternioninline
Quaternion(Real *valptr)OgreMathLib::Quaternioninline
Slerp(Real fT, const Quaternion &rkP, const Quaternion &rkQ, bool shortestPath=false) (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ternionstatic
SlerpExtraSpins(Real fT, const Quaternion &rkP, const Quaternion &rkQ, int iExtraSpins) (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ternionstatic
Squad(Real fT, const Quaternion &rkP, const Quaternion &rkA, const Quaternion &rkB, const Quaternion &rkQ, bool shortestPath=false) (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ternionstatic
swap(Quaternion &other)OgreMathLib::Quaternioninline
to_s() const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ternioninline
ToAngleAxis(Radian &rfAngle, Vector3 &rkAxis) const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
ToAngleAxis(Degree &dAngle, Vector3 &rkAxis) const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ternioninline
ToAxes(Vector3 *akAxis) const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
ToAxes(Vector3 &xAxis, Vector3 &yAxis, Vector3 &zAxis) const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
ToRotationMatrix(Matrix3 &kRot) const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
UnitInverse() const (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
w (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
x (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
xAxis(void) constOgreMathLib::Quaternion
y (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
yAxis(void) constOgreMathLib::Quaternion
z (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ternion
zAxis(void) constOgreMathLib::Quaternion
ZERO (defined in OgreMathLib::Quaternion)OgreMathLib::Quaternionstatic